SPECIFICATIONS

Parameters
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 16-SOIC (0.295, 7.50mm Width)
Number of Pins 16
Operating Temperature -40°C~85°C
Packaging Tape & Reel (TR)
Published 2014
JESD-609 Code e3
Pbfree Code yes
Part Status Obsolete
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 16
Terminal Finish Matte Tin (Sn)
Subcategory Other Converters
Max Power Dissipation 450mW
Technology CMOS
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 15V
Time@Peak Reflow Temperature-Max (s) NOT SPECIFIED
Base Part Number MX7533
Pin Count 16
Qualification Status Not Qualified
Output Type Current - Unbuffered
Max Supply Voltage 16.5V
Min Supply Voltage 5V
Number of Bits 10
Supply Current-Max 2mA
Architecture R-2R
Converter Type D/A CONVERTER
Supply Type Single
Reference Type External
Data Interface Parallel
Differential Output Yes
Resolution 1.25 B
Voltage - Supply, Analog 5V~16.5V
Voltage - Supply, Digital 5V~16.5V
Settling Time 800ns
Input Bit Code BINARY, OFFSET BINARY
Number of Converters 1
Height Seated (Max) 2.65mm
Width 7.5mm
RoHS Status ROHS3 Compliant
Lead Free Lead Free
